How It Works
Every session is structured around three things: find the gaps, understand why they exist, and give you a plan to address them.
Students sit an exam-standard paper covering the key concepts from Term 1. No help, no hints — exactly like the real thing. This is where the data comes from.
What this reveals: concept gaps, time management, careless patterns
Our tutor goes through every question — the right approach, where students typically go wrong, and why certain errors happen. Students mark their own work as they learn.
What this builds: self-awareness, correction habits, exam technique
We sit down with you (via Zoom or onsite) and walk you through your child's graded paper, their specific gaps, and what to prioritise in Term 2. You leave knowing exactly what your child needs — and what they don't. For a lot of parents, that clarity alone is worth the trip.

For P5, P6, S1, S4 & S4 Additional Math
For P5 and P6, we run separate sessions for Paper 1 and Paper 2 — each with their own diagnostic focus. For S1 and S4 (including Additional Math), we combine a content lesson covering a key concept with a full assessment session, so students both learn and are tested.
P5 & P6: Paper 1 session + Paper 2 session — full coverage of Term 1 syllabus
S1: Algebra content lesson + Term 1 diagnostic assessment
S4 (E Math & A Math): Key concept teaching session + full Term 1 assessment
